Different sites give me different answers. I actually have a 1999 Chevy Prizm, which is essentially a Toyota Corolla. I am trying to find good speakers that will fit my front door panels. I am also trying to put in a new cd player without losing my push-in cup holder. I can't even find a pocket to fill the space on the web.
Crutchfield says Pioneer will work in a Toyota but not in a Prizm. eTronics says just the opposite. I live in a part of the country where I can't just walk into a store and ask questions and listen ahead. I took the amps and subs out of my old truck and want to use them in the car. I had Boston Acoustic 61/2 components in my truck. They are too deep to use in the Prizm doors. The amps are good and the subs fit in my trunk just fine. If I could just find a head unit, a pocket and some speakers!!!!!
